e5899099ab ARM: dts: stm32: Adjust PLL4 settings on AV96
The PLL4 is supplying SDMMC12, SDMMC3 and SPDIF with 120 MHz and
FDCAN with 96 MHz. This isn't good for the SDMMC interfaces, which
can not easily divide the clock down to e.g. 50 MHz for high speed
SD and eMMC devices, so those devices end up running at 30 MHz as
that is 120 MHz / 4. Adjust the PLL4 settings such that both PLL4P
and PLL4R run at 100 MHz instead, which is easy to divide to 50MHz
for optimal operation of both SD and eMMC, SPDIF clock are not that
much slower and FDCAN is also unaffected.

4a45f4046b dts: imx: Add fixed-link property to HSC and DDC (imx53) devices
Those two boards are supposed to be run with a single u-boot binary.
There are notable differences though - HSC uses DSA switch (which
phy_id == 0x0) and DCC (DP83848C).

After the commit 3bf135b6c3
("drivers: net: phy: Ignore PHY ID 0 during PHY probing") the PHY devices
with phy_id == 0 are not created in U-Boot anymore. This caused regression
on HSC.

To fix this problem - the fec's 'fixed-link' node has been introduced and
the phy_id is not assessed anymore. This approach works on both boards.

15df6b31b6 ARM: imx6: DHCOM i.MX6 PDK: Convert to DM_ETH
Use DM_ETH instead of legacy networking.  Add VIO as a fixed regulator
to the relevant device-trees and augment the FEC node with properties
for the reset GPIO.

It should be noted that the relevant properties for the reset GPIO
already exist in the PHY node (reset-gpios, reset-delay-us,
reset-post-delay-us) but U-Boot currently ignores those and only
supports the bus-level reset properties in the FEC node
(phy-reset-gpios, phy-reset-duration, phy-reset-post-delay).

Fabio Estevam
4c13a4db60 wandboard: Fix version detection for mx6q/mx6dl revD1
The detection of the revD1 version is based on the presence of the PMIC.

Currently revb1 device trees are used for mx6q/mx6dl variants, which
do not have the PMIC nodes.

This causes revD1 boards to be incorrectly be detected as revB1.

Fix this issue by using the revd1 device trees, so that the PMIC node can be
found and then the PMIC can be detected by reading its register ID.

Imported the revd1 device trees from mainline kernel version 5.7-rc1.

Amit Kumar Mahapatra
0546b1ab06 arm64: zynqmp: Do not duplicate flash partition label property
In kernel 5.4, support has been added for reading MTD devices via
the nvmem API.
For this the mtd devices are registered as read-only NVMEM providers
under sysfs with the same name as the flash partition label property.

So if flash partition label property of multiple flash devices are identical
then the second mtd device fails to get registered as a NVMEM provider.

This patch fixes the issue by having different label property for different
flashes.

7c02bc9649 ARM: tegra: Add NVIDIA Jetson Nano Developer Kit support
The Jetson Nano Developer Kit is a Tegra X1-based development board. It
is similar to Jetson TX1 but it is not pin compatible. It features 4GB
of LPDDR4, a SPI NOR flash for early boot firmware and an SD card slot
used for storage.

HDMI 2.0 or DP 1.2 are available for display, four USB ports (3 USB 2.0
and 1 USB 3.0) can be used to attach a variety of peripherals and a PCI
Ethernet controller provides onboard network connectivity. NVMe support
has also been added. Env save is at the end of QSPI (4MB-8K).

A 40-pin header on the board can be used to extend the capabilities and
exposed interfaces of the Jetson Nano.
